About THE PLANTATION GARDEN PRESERVATION TRUST
THE PLANTATION GARDEN PRESERVATION TRUST is a registered charity in England and Wales (registration number 1165433). Based on official Charity Commission data, it holds a "Verified" rating with a CharityScore of 80/100 — a well-rated and transparent charity that meets strong governance standards. This indicates a reliable charity with strong fundamentals across most of our assessment criteria. In its most recent reporting year (2025), THE PLANTATION GARDEN PRESERVATION TRUST reported a total income of £85,661 and total expenditure of £107,200, a spending ratio of 125% indicating a strong proportion of funds directed to charitable work. According to the Charity Commission register, THE PLANTATION GARDEN PRESERVATION TRUST describes its activities as follows: The restoration and preservation, for the public benefit, of the Gardens at 4 Earlham Road, Norwich, known as The Plantation Garden. Our analysis found no significant governance concerns for THE PLANTATION GARDEN PRESERVATION TRUST. No regulatory actions, filing failures, or financial anomalies were detected in the available public data.
